What is a CS2 Casino?

A CS2 gambling establishment is a third-party online platform that enables gamers to bet utilizing virtual weapon skins, cases, or real-world currency converted into platform credits. Since Valve (the designer of CS2) incorporated a peer-to-peer trading system and Steam Community Market years earlier, virtual products got concrete, real-world financial worth.

Third-party entrepreneurs taken advantage of this by developing independent gambling platforms where players can bet their digital stocks in hopes of increasing their virtual wealth.

The Economics of CS2 Skins

To understand CS2 gambling establishments, one should understand the underlying economy. Weapon skins do not change gameplay; they are purely cosmetic. However, their deficiency, use condition, and visual appeal dictate their market price.

Skin Tier Rarity Cost Range (Approximate) Consumer/ Industrial Typical ₤ 0.03-- ₤ 0.50 Mil-Spec/ Restricted Uncommon ₤ 0.50-- ₤ 10.00 Categorized/ Covert Rare ₤ 10.00-- ₤ 500.00+ Knives/ Gloves Ultra-Rare ₤ 100.00-- ₤ 1,500,000+

Because unusual knives and gloves can command rates equivalent to luxury automobiles, players are naturally drawn to high-risk, high-reward methods of obtaining them, which is where CS2 casinos step in.

Popular Games Found on CS2 Casinos

CS2 gambling platforms typically feature a mix of conventional casino games re-skinned with a Counter-Strike aesthetic, alongside video games unique to the video game gambling sector.

1. Case Battles

Standard CS2 case openings are a solo endeavor. Case battles present a multiplayer, competitive element.

  • How it works: Two or more gamers pay an entry fee to open the very same set of virtual cases. At the end of the round, the player whose opened products have the greatest overall market price wins the entire contents of all opened cases.

2. Crash

Borrowing from cryptocurrency trading aesthetic appeals, Crash is one of the most popular games on modern gambling sites.

  • How it works: A multiplier begins at 1.00 x and begins climbing rapidly. Gamers need to "cash out" before the multiplier randomly crashes. If the crash occurs before a player squanders, they lose their wager.

3. Live Roulette/ Coin Flip

Simple games developed for fast rounds.

  • Coin Flip: A 50/50 heads-or-tails design game where 2 gamers wager equal skin worths, and a digital coin figures out the winner.
  • Live roulette: Players bank on colors (usually red, black, or green) with varying payout odds.

4. Upgrade

A mechanic unique to skin gambling sites.

  • How it works: A gamer picks a skin from their inventory that they want to trade up, picks a target skin of greater value, and spins a wheel. The wheel's success zone diminishes or grows depending upon the mathematical distinction in between the two products' worths.

Benefits and drawbacks of CS2 Gambling Platforms

While these sites offer home entertainment and the adventure of potential profit, they run in a legal and ethical gray location.

Benefits for Users

  • Entertainment Value: For numerous, the thriller of opening cases or playing crash adds an extra layer of engagement to the gaming experience.
  • Liquidity: Some platforms allow users to cash out jackpots via cryptocurrency, bank transfers, or alternative payment approaches.
  • Neighborhood Features: Features like live chat, rain (totally free site currency dispersed to active chat users), and leaderboards promote a strong sense of neighborhood.

Inherent Risks

  • Financial Loss: Like all forms of gambling, your home constantly has a mathematical edge. A lot of individuals lose more than they win.
  • Absence of Regulation: Because these sites are third-party entities operating outside official Valve oversight, consumer security laws are hardly ever enforced.
  • Rip-offs and Fraud: Unscrupulous websites may control chances, refuse withdrawals, or vanish over night.
  • Underage Gambling: Despite age-verification triggers, numerous platforms lack robust KYC (Know Your Customer) procedures, making them available to minors.

Valve's Stance and Counter-Measures

Valve has actually not remained passive relating to the skin gambling phenomenon. Throughout the years, the designer has executed a number of updates to suppress unauthorized gambling:

  • Trade Holds: Valve introduced a 7-day trade limitation on products traded in between accounts, slowing down the rapid cycling of skins on gambling websites.
  • Cease and Desist Letters: The company has actually occasionally targeted significant skin gambling networks, demanding they closed down their bot accounts and operations.
  • API Restrictions: Changes to Steam's Application Programming Interface (API) have actually made it harder for automated gambling bots to operate efficiently.

Despite these efforts, operators constantly find workaround methods, using peer-to-peer listing systems or cryptocurrency intermediaries to bypass direct Steam inventory transfers.

Finest Practices and Safety Tips

If individuals choose to engage with the CS2 casino ecosystem, working out extreme care is vital. Complying with basic digital hygiene guidelines can avoid considerable financial and account security losses:

  • Set Strict Budgets: Never gamble money or skins that you can not manage to lose totally.
  • Research the Platform: Look for evaluations, community consensus, and transparent Provably Fair algorithms (systems that permit users to verify that video game results were not controlled).
  • Secure Your Steam Account: Never log into third-party websites using compromised or insecure credentials. Enable Steam Guard Mobile Authenticator at all times.
  • Acknowledge Problem Gambling: If gambling stops being a kind of casual home entertainment and begins triggering monetary or mental distress, seek assistance immediately.
